He is 47 years old, a Telangana state government department officer with 19 years of service, and has been carrying sustained clinical anxiety for over 7 years. The pressures are specific to government service realities. Transfer anxiety that recurs every few years as transfer cycles approach. Political pressure from changing administrations affecting working priorities and personal positioning. Sustained hierarchical pressure from senior officers and political leadership. Public scrutiny of decisions through RTI and media attention. File pendency pressure with deadlines that exceed practical capacity. Promotion politics that affect career trajectory beyond merit considerations. The accumulation across nearly two decades has produced sustained anxiety, sleep disruption, and family relationship strain that he has been managing alone through willpower while continuing to perform his duties. The 6 Hidden Signs Government Servant Stress Has Crossed Clinical Lines

Sign 1 — Transfer Cycle Anxiety That Recurs Predictably

Sustained anxiety that recurs predictably as transfer cycles approach every few years. Sleep disruption during transfer evaluation periods. Family disruption from posting uncertainty. Sign 2 — Sustained Worry From Political Pressure

Background worry from political pressure, administration changes, and superior demands that does not resolve when specific situations are addressed. New worries emerge to replace resolved ones. Sign 3 — Physical Symptoms During High-Pressure Periods

Chest tightness, gastrointestinal problems, headaches, sleep disruption during high-pressure periods that persist for weeks afterward. The physical manifestations of sustained psychological stress indicate the cumulative impact has crossed into territory requiring proper clinical attention.

Sign 4 — Decision Avoidance Patterns Affecting Service

Avoidance patterns affecting decision-making, file processing, and service responsibilities. The avoidance produces relief in the short term but compounds over time. Sign 5 — Family Relationship Strain From Service Stress

Marriage strain, parenting difficulties, and family relationship deterioration from service stress impact. The transferred stress affects whole household across years. Sign 6 — Substance Use to Manage Service Pressure

Increased alcohol use during stressful service periods or other substance use as coping mechanism for sustained service stress. Substance use as coping creates compound problems that integrated care addresses comprehensively.
